Origin
Gracias, located in the Lempira department of Honduras, serves as a strategic logistics hub in western Honduras, positioned advantageously for accessing both domestic markets and international export routes. The region is characterized by its strong agricultural sector, producing coffee, vegetables, and tropical fruits, alongside growing manufacturing activities in textiles and light industrial goods. The city's infrastructure includes access to major highways connecting to San Pedro Sula and the Caribbean coast, providing essential links to ports for international shipping. Local transportation networks support efficient cargo consolidation and distribution, making Gracias an important origin point for cross-border freight movements.
Destination
Carson City
Carson City, the capital of Nevada, occupies a strategic position in the western United States, serving as a key logistics node for the Sierra Nevada region and the broader western market. The city's proximity to major transportation corridors, including Interstate 580 and US Route 50, provides excellent connectivity to Reno, Sacramento, and the San Francisco Bay Area. Carson City's industrial base includes manufacturing, technology, and distribution sectors, with significant warehousing and logistics infrastructure supporting regional supply chains. The city's location near major distribution centers and its access to interstate highways make it an ideal destination for cross-border freight, facilitating efficient last-mile delivery throughout the western United States.
